I met Saraya Van Dreumel a June afternoon. Nerlander, who arrived Milan 2018, founded his brand after years of research and a deep passion for the gara, born ten years punzone when she started integrating it into her morning routine. Me, Milanese with a weakness for eastern culture, I had been trying for some time to understand more: that aggraziato dust had marked every breakfast of my last trip to Asia.

Our chat began with a tasting of Awaken Matcha – the tea that Saraya selects and imports from a small farm the prefecture of Kagoshima, the south of Japan. “I was looking for an alternative to , which caused me migraines,” he says. “But finding a anche se and controlled gara was almost impossible.” After numerous contacts with local farmers, he discovered a volcanic soil rich nutrients and without heavy metals.

Its tea is stone – now rare ancestral technique – and tested to guarantee its purity. “The real gara grows the shade for at least 21 days, to increase chlorophyll and l-teanine, and collects spring by choosing only the most nutritious leaves,” he explains. Without this process, it loses its functional properties. From that simposio I understood that the gara is not all the same: here are the Milanese addresses, selected with the contribution of Saraya, where to taste the authentic one.

Matcha Per Pinzare

Photo by Anastasia Goncharova

Have you ever tasted a Basca Cheesecake at Matcha? Noï, new opening, celebrates campo da golf tea all its forms, using Shizuoka’s ceremonial gara exclusively. Durante paper: Matcha lattemiele, also with mango strawberry, Matcha tonic and anche se tea. Behind the showcase: creamy cakes, Dorayaki with Azuki, drowned ice cream and brownie. Soon it will also be possible to buy their gara and other Japanese mixtures.

Experiential tasting

best-Matcha-Milan-Seed
Photo by Carlotta Orcio

The Seed is a place where the gara becomes the protagonist of energizing drinks and snacks. The dust, selected by Saraya herself, is stone until it becomes ultrafine. The result is a velvety gara, with delicate taste and perfect foam. Durante addition to the classic Matcha , it is found the protein Power Balls, ideal for starting the day with energy.

A calcio d’angolo of Japan

best-Matcha-Milan-Pan

Pan is a crossroads of cultures the Capoluogo Studi district. The gara comes from spring collections, selected by a Japanese family with which Alice Yamada, owner, has a direct relationship. Durante the lista: Matcha hot and cold milk, Croissant with Matcha cream, blondie, cookies and the classic Shokupan – not to be missed.

Sweet tradition

best-Matcha-Milan-Mokos

Since 2015, Moko’s has been synonymous with ceremonial gara and artisan Japanese sweets. The restaurant offers fair trade tea, professional tools for home preparation and a range of desserts that ranges from mochi to muffins, from a thousand crêpes to cookies cakes. Everything is produced the internal laboratory, where the gara is the absolute protagonist.
